New eunicellin-base diterpenoids, hirsutalins I-M (1-5), were isolated from the soft coral Cladiella hirsuta. Their structures were elucidated by spectroscopic methods, particularly in 1D and 2D NMR experiments. The absolute configuration of 2 was determined by Mosher's method. These compounds did not exhibit cytotoxicity toward a limited panel of cancer cell lines but showed nitric oxide inhibitory activity in LPS-stimulated RAW264.7 macrophage cells. Among them, compound 3 was found to possess the strongest NO inhibitory activity with an IC50 value of 9.8 μg/mL. Furthermore, 3 was shown to significantly reduce the expression iNOS protein in the same cells.
